The operation of internal cylindrical grinding machines is relatively difficult, and we need to pay attention to some of the challenges. Operators must feed slowly to prevent accidents caused by the machine's low sensitivity; when measuring workpieces with a gauge or instrument, the abrasive wheel should be withdrawn from the workpiece and stopped to prevent the abrasive wheel from suddenly running automatically. When measuring workpieces with a gauge, the gauge must be withdrawn steadily to avoid affecting the measurement accuracy. When replacing or correcting the abrasive wheel, general safety procedures for grinders should be followed to enhance the level of safety.
